Excerpt from the Quillstone build migration doc, for support: we are moving the legacy make-based build to Hermia, a hermetic build system. All toolchains are pinned; network access during builds is disabled. Expect cache misses during the cutover week, so build times tickets are anticipated. Escalate only if a build exceeds the timeout ceiling. The scheduler's knobs are fixed fleet-wide and tracked in version control; the current settings are listed below.

tuning constants:
BUDGETS = {
    "druath": 240,
    "lamwyn": 180,
    "silael": 275,
}

## Deployment

Heads up: the Tallybook export worker is memory-hungry when big spreadsheets get generated, so we run it on the larger Fenwick nodes with streaming writes enabled. Don't bump the row buffer without checking with the infra folks first. The worker picks up its settings at boot from the values below.

service settings:
[istox]
host = istox.qorvelforge.internal
user = istox_svc
database = istox_prod

# Break-Glass: Catalog Cache Invalidation

Scope: the Pinrow product catalog at Veldstone Retail. If stale prices persist after a purge and the Hollowmere invalidation queue is wedged, use break-glass to flush the edge tier directly. Contractors: get verbal sign-off from the catalog lead first. Steps: open the Hollowmere admin shell, select emergency-flush, confirm the tenant, and run it once — repeated flushes thrash the origin. Access is logged and expires after 20 minutes. Unseal the admin shell with the passphrase below.

recovery phrase for kahop-tajog: istix-casvan

Checklist item 4 — Export retries (Cindervale Reports). Verify the retry worker picks up failed exports within five minutes, respects the exponential backoff ceiling, and marks exports dead after six attempts rather than looping forever. New team members: check the dead-letter dashboard after each release, since silent retry storms have bitten us twice. Once verified, record the outcome against the build token that appears below.

build token for tawip-yageg: htk9_92ac43d42